A reliable bloomer originally from James Fang at HOF, the cross is 'Smile of Goddess' x 'Witchen'. Three flowers open, with 3 more buds on the way. The flower quality is not as good as with previous bloomings, but I have been traveling a lot this summer and I think some lapses in culture can explain that. Regardless, it is still going to put on a good show, despite the grower! Some threads with photos of last year's bloomings are HERE and HERE.
